Johann Friedrich Bauer (medical doctor)
Johann Friedrich Bauer (* 1696 in Leipzig ; † December 22, 1744 ibid) was a German physician and assessor at the medical faculty of the University of Leipzig .
Life
Johann Friedrich Bauer studied medicine at the University of Leipzig , received his doctorate in 1721 and then an assessor at the medical faculty of the University of Leipzig. Bauer also worked as a doctor and city physician in Leipzig.
On June 24, 1726 Johann Friedrich Bauer with the academic surname Chrysermus was elected member ( matriculation no. 388 ) of the Leopoldina .
Johann Friedrich Bauer was buried in the Johanniskirchhof in Leipzig.
